Instructions:
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Slice the jalapeños in half lengthwise and remove the seeds and membranes.
- Place a small chunk of brie into each jalapeño half.
- Spoon about 1/2 teaspoon of blueberry jam over the brie.
- Wrap each stuffed jalapeño with a slice of prosciutto.
- Arrange the wrapped poppers on a baking sheet and bake for 12–15 minutes, or until the prosciutto is crisp and the brie is melted.
- Add a pinch of black pepper if desired and serve warm.
Variations
• Use fig jam or apricot preserves for a different sweet contrast.
• Swap brie for goat cheese or cream cheese for a tangier filling.
• Add a thin slice of apple or pear under the brie for extra sweetness and texture.
• Drizzle with hot honey for a sweet-spicy finish.
Tips

• Choose jalapeños of similar size for even cooking.
• Don’t overfill the jalapeños — brie melts quickly and may spill if packed too high.
• Line your baking sheet with parchment for easy cleanup.
• For an elegant finish, drizzle warm blueberry jam over the poppers just before serving.
